Immigration recruits travel to Curacao.

policerecriuts30082009Airport: --- On Sunday August 30, a group of 18 recruits traveled on Insel Air to Curacao to attend the Police Academy in Curacao, where they will be training to become Immigration officers. Eight recruits are from the sister island of St Eustatius and ten are from St Maarten.

The training will have duration of approximately six months, which will take place in Curacao for the entire duration. On Friday the Acting Chief of Police Commissioner Ademar Doran, in the presence of the Coordinator of the recruitment program Chief Inspector Carl John and Inspector Ricardo Henson, spoke to the recruits regarding to their training and what is expected of them. Doran also gave them many words of encouragement and wished them much success.
